Job Description:

This travel assignment places ER Registered Nurses in a busy Level I Trauma Center, primarily covering triage duties during 12-hour night shifts. You will be responsible for assessing walk-in patients in the waiting room, making quick, accurate decisions, and functioning within a high-paced emergency department environment. There is an opportunity to cross-train in other clinical areas based on staffing needs. This role requires at least 2 years of triage experience in a similar hospital setting, with certifications in TNCC, ACLS, and BLS. Nurses will have the chance to work on a block schedule, with guaranteed hours for 13 weeks, gaining valuable experience in a renowned acute care facility.
